Pull to refresh

Comments 41

Учитывая что в последнее время пользователи обленились писать и шлют голосовые сообщения, то писать напоминания будут единицы. Увы это реалии нашего текущего мира.
Значит прикручу к этому боту сервис распознавания голосовых сообщений, как в моем ВКшном боте.
Спасибо за идею!

У SpeechKit Яндекса неплохой SDK и распознавание русскоязычной речи лучше чем у wit.ai.

image
Какой-то пробел объявился в "что-нибудь" — баг?
И бот так и не смог мне ответить, выдаёт ошибку.

Какой-то пробел объявился в «что-нибудь» — баг?

Да, спасибо, исправил, теперь бот не добавляет лишних пробелов.
И бот так и не смог мне ответить, выдаёт ошибку.

Можете написать мне в телеграмме или сообщить на гитхабе какую ошибку он пишет?

Круто, но все голосовые помощники в телефоне это умеют и очень хорошо((

Ну, голос сейчас все в облаке распознают, по-другому просто не бывает.

Бывает. Вы просто плохо искали:



Но между "распознавать" и "распознавать хорошо" большая разница, а "хорошо распознавать русский язык" ещё сложнее, потому что тренировочных данных (а тем более хороших) для нейросетей сильно меньше по понятным причинам.

Именно так. Всё, что не в облаке — отстой, который даже не стоит принимать во внимание.
UFO landed and left these words here
Спасибо.
Первую идею я точно реализую, это именно то, чего по моему ощущению не хватало боту.
По поводу второй идеи — это уже реализовано в групповых беседах: просто упомяните нужного пользователя через @ и бот тоже упомянет его в уведомлении.
Если в будущем получится сделать голосовое распознавание текста, тогда попробуйте создать приложение для Android: «Голосовые напоминания offline». Сейчас много приложение требуют доступа в интернет т.к. много операций проходят на стороне сервера, а у вас свой сервер и всё свое. Если получится работать в offline тогда часть параноиков пользователей скажет вам большое спасибо.
UFO landed and left these words here
Если получится отвязаться от все сторонних приложение которые слушают, что ты говоришь и отправляют третьим лицам твои данные — тогда будет еще одно приложение для параноиков и простых людей которые следят за своей безопасностью. Я надеюсь в этом смысл этого приложения.

Кому стоит доверять больше, гуглу или рандомному боту из телеграма? Параноика, вероятно, ни один из вариантов не устроит.
UFO landed and left these words here
Это сейчас бот в телеграме сидит и через него все работает. Но в будущем можно сделать все полностью offline т.к. есть все для этого необходимые части и все алгоритмы.
Можно попробовать прикрутить повторяющиеся напоминания, например: ходить в спорт зал каждую среду и пятницу начиная с…
UFO landed and left these words here
Почему именно бот? Есть разные блокноты, хранящие в себе кучу полезной и рассортированной информации.Для этих целей я использую Notion

Telegram — очень удобная платформа, можно с любого устройства взаимодействовать с чем-либо без приложения.


Я, например, настроил себе Gmail в телеграм и еще поднял внутренний бот для баг-репортов из одного проекта

Очень крутой проект!

Для меня именно распознавание даты из обычного текста — главная киллер фича в Todoist
Сейчас ваш бот проигрывает ему лишь отсутсвием виджета
Вы молодец. Статье не хватает только неочевидного для некоторых людей, воспринимающих ботов как магию от Дурова, упоминания о том, что вам доступна контактная информация людей, пишущих боту и все их запросы, даже если вы её реально не читаете. Это вообще беда всех ботов — если для сайтов начали упоминать про куки, то в телеге доступно гораздо больше информации.
Это правда, к сожалению я не могу закрыть самому себе доступ к своей базе данных.
И поэтому я и выложил весь исходный код проекта, чтобы каждый человек в случае необходимости мог развернуть подобного бота у себя.
Если кому-то интересно, то могу написать небольшую инструкцию в отдельном посте как развернуть этого бота на heroku совершенно бесплатно с бесперебойной работой 24/7.
И поэтому я и выложил весь исходный код проекта

Именно поэтому я и написал, что вы молодец.
Мне интересно узнать как залить на хероку чтоб он постоянно не падал.

Мне бы интеграцию с Google Calendar, украинский язык и аудиосообщения — и я бы пользовался)


Автор молодец. Лично я "тоже могу такое сделать", но взять идею, реализовать ее, сделать не только продукт "для себя" но и для многих пользователей и еще статью написать — могут единицы.

Хороший инструмент.
Нужно поправить его работу в соответствии с несколькими кейсами:


Заканчиваем спринт 10 августа в 11
Can not schedule for this date


Заканчиваем спринт десятого августа в 11
Can not schedule for this date


Заканчиваем спринт первого августа
Can not schedule for this date


Заканчиваем спринт у 31 июля в 20
Can not schedule for this date


Закончить спринт 10 августа 20 года в час дня
Can not schedule for this date

В данный момент чтобы сделать напоминание необходимо указать точный час.
Распознавание отдельных чисел как часов планируется добавить в виде дополнительной настройки, так как она может сильно загрязнять групповой чат.
Спасибо! аудио распознавание прям необходимо, иначе по трудозатратам равносильно заметке в календаре, а еще лучше к голосовой колонке впоследствии прикреплять с напоминанием в боте в телеграмме, для рабочих задач)
Поддержка распознавания голосовых сообщений добавлена.

Интересно, полезно)
Я планах есть интеграция с, к примеру, гугл календарем? Было бы очень удобно для наглядности в итоге.

С API гугл календаря не знаком, но как будет время постараюсь его изучить, и, возможно, добавлю боту возможность взаимодействия с календарем.
Интересная статья, подчеркнул для себя важные моменты для переработки парсера в будущем, за что большое спасибо.
А боту нужно просто час указать, сделано для того, чтобы в групповых беседах меньше реагировал и не так засорял чат:
image
Добавлена функция повторного напоминания.
Нажмите на кнопку под уведомлением чтобы бот напомнил о нём ещё раз через 5 минут.
По прошествии 5 минут данная кнопка исчезнет автоматически.
image

image
Only those users with full accounts are able to leave comments. Log in, please.